El Carnicero presents Olde Wrestling’s Speakeasy Spectacular

Huzzah!!! Olde Wrestling is making its debut in the grand city of Lakewood for a night of rough n’ tumble, eye gougin, bodyslammin, rip roarin, old fashioned wrestling!

The Speakeasy Spectacular is a one-night event (Friday, August 1st) celebrating the secret saloons that became widely popular during the Prohibition era. The Spectacular will feature professional wrestling contests from characters that reflect those rambunctious roarin’ 20s: Bootleggers, Prohibition Agents, Skilled Grapplers, Fierce Lady Wrestlers, Speakeasy Strongmen, and Bare Knuckle Pugilists will all be fighting inside the infamous squared circle.

We’ve partnered with Eric Williams (Momocho & Happy Dog chef/owner) Lakewood Lucha Libre themed restaurant El Carnicero to expand our audience throughout the Cleveland metro area.

Although wrestling will be the feature attraction, we are concentrating on creating a fun and enjoyable atmosphere that will take the audience back to the age of the Charleston and President Hoover. In addition to our vintage grappling contests, the Spectacular will showcase Cleveland vaudeville duo, Pinch & Squeal, performing between matches. Yelp Cleveland and additional vintage reenactors will be interacting with the crowd as well.
